Sapphire applicator tubes are specialized components used in semiconductor plasma and process equipment where the tube may be exposed to microwave or RF energy, reactive process gases, elevated temperatures and plasma-generated species.
In remote plasma systems, process gas can pass through an applicator tube while microwave energy is coupled into the applicator region to generate reactive plasma species. Sapphire is particularly suitable for this type of application because of its combination of thermal stability, electrical insulation, chemical resistance and microwave/RF transmission characteristics.

The applicator tube is manufactured from synthetic sapphire suitable for demanding semiconductor equipment environments.
Sapphire provides excellent resistance to high temperature, plasma exposure and chemically aggressive process conditions while maintaining high mechanical strength.
Sapphire tubes are widely used in semiconductor processing applications including plasma applicator tubes, plasma containment tubes, process gas injector components and related plasma-generation systems.
Sapphire offers excellent dielectric characteristics and RF/microwave transmission capability, making it suitable for components positioned within microwave or remote plasma generation systems.

The applicator tube is located in one of the more demanding areas of a plasma generation system.
Depending on equipment design, the tube may simultaneously encounter reactive gases, energetic plasma species, microwave energy and elevated temperatures.
